Upload a work plan (Attachment 2) that demonstrates how you will use OVC funds to develop, implement, and evaluate innovative, evidence-based strategies Webdecisions about allocating evaluation resources. Evaluation findings can clarify what indicators are predictive of an activity’s success and should be tracked in performance measurement. Evaluation can provide context and potential explanations for variation over time or across sites revealed by performance measurement.
